示例#2
0
        private void Connect()
        {
            Uri uri = CurrentRequest.HasProxy ? CurrentRequest.Proxy.Address : CurrentRequest.CurrentUri;

            if (Client == null)
            {
                Client = new TcpClient();
            }

            if (!Client.Connected)
            {
                Client.ConnectTimeout = CurrentRequest.ConnectTimeout;

#if NETFX_CORE
                Client.UseHTTPSProtocol = !CurrentRequest.UseAlternateSSL && HTTPProtocolFactory.IsSecureProtocol(uri);

                // On WinRT and >WP8 we use the more secure Tls12 protocol, but on WP8 only Ssl is available...
                #if UNITY_WP_8_1 || UNITY_METRO_8_1
                Client.HTTPSProtocol = (int)SocketProtectionLevel.Tls12;
                #else
                Client.HTTPSProtocol = (int)SocketProtectionLevel.Ssl;
                #endif
#endif
                Client.Connect(uri.Host, uri.Port);

                HTTPManager.Logger.Information("HTTPConnection", "Connected to " + uri.Host);
            }
            else
            {
                HTTPManager.Logger.Information("HTTPConnection", "Already connected to " + uri.Host);
            }

            lock (HTTPManager.Locker)
                StartTime = DateTime.UtcNow;

            if (Stream == null)
            {
                if (HasProxy && !Proxy.IsTransparent)
                {
                    Stream = Client.GetStream();

                    var outStream = new BinaryWriter(Stream);
                    outStream.Write(string.Format("CONNECT {0}:{1} HTTP/1.1", CurrentRequest.CurrentUri.Host, CurrentRequest.CurrentUri.Port).GetASCIIBytes());
                    outStream.Write(HTTPRequest.EOL);

                    outStream.Write(string.Format("Proxy-Connection: Keep-Alive"));
                    outStream.Write(HTTPRequest.EOL);

                    outStream.Write(string.Format("Connection: Keep-Alive"));
                    outStream.Write(HTTPRequest.EOL);

                    outStream.Write(string.Format("Host: {0}:{1}", CurrentRequest.CurrentUri.Host, CurrentRequest.CurrentUri.Port).GetASCIIBytes());
                    outStream.Write(HTTPRequest.EOL);

                    outStream.Write(HTTPRequest.EOL);
                    outStream.Flush();

                    CurrentRequest.ProxyResponse = new HTTPProxyResponse(CurrentRequest, Stream, false, false);
                    if (!CurrentRequest.ProxyResponse.Receive())
                    {
                        throw new Exception("Connection to the Proxy Server failed!");
                    }

                    // TODO: check & handle proxy status code?
                }

                // We have to use CurrentRequest.CurrentUri here, becouse uri can be a proxy uri with a different protocol
                if (HTTPProtocolFactory.IsSecureProtocol(CurrentRequest.CurrentUri))
                {
                    // On WP8 there are no Mono, so we must use the 'alternate' TlsHandlers
                    if (CurrentRequest.UseAlternateSSL)
                    {
                        var handler = new TlsClientProtocol(Client.GetStream(), new Org.BouncyCastle.Security.SecureRandom());
                        if (CurrentRequest.CustomCertificateVerifyer == null)
                        {
                            handler.Connect(new LegacyTlsClient(new AlwaysValidVerifyer()));
                        }
                        else
                        {
                            handler.Connect(new LegacyTlsClient(CurrentRequest.CustomCertificateVerifyer));
                        }
                        Stream = handler.Stream;
                    }
                    else
                    {
#if !UNITY_WP8 && !NETFX_CORE
                        SslStream sslStream = new SslStream(Client.GetStream(), false, (sender, cert, chain, errors) =>
                        {
                            return(CurrentRequest.CallCustomCertificationValidator(cert, chain));
                        });

                        if (!sslStream.IsAuthenticated)
                        {
                            sslStream.AuthenticateAsClient(uri.Host);
                        }
                        Stream = sslStream;
#else
                        Stream = Client.GetStream();
#endif
                    }
                }
                else
                {
                    Stream = Client.GetStream();
                }
            }
        }
